Whiteness, brightness, colour and opacity testing
These surface optical properties are used in most specifications to define the visual quality of paper and board. The tests can be made on a range of materials including tissue, paper, copy paper, coated board, carton board and papers for most printing applications.
CIE whiteness, brightness, L*a*b* colour and opacity are all measured using a Technidyne Colourtouch PC spectrophotometer with a range of light sources.
Pira's UKAS, ISO 17025 accredited testing is performed to the following British standard and International standards: whiteness to BS ISO 11475; brightness to BS ISO 2470; colour to ISO 5631 and opacity to BS ISO 2471.
